Lysosomal Acid Lipase Deficiency Treatment Market, Segmentation by Therapy Type
The Lysosomal Acid Lipase Deficiency Treatment Market has been segmented by Therapy Type into Liver Transplant and Hematopoietic Stem Cell Transplant.
Liver Transplant
The liver transplant segment represents a critical treatment approach for patients with advanced stages of Lysosomal Acid Lipase Deficiency (LAL-D), particularly when liver failure has progressed. Approximately 25% to 30% of patients with severe LAL-D may require a transplant due to progressive liver damage. Despite its complexity, liver transplantation offers a significant survival advantage, although it comes with long-term immunosuppressive therapy and potential complications. The success rate post-transplantation has improved, making this option viable for eligible candidates.
Hematopoietic Stem Cell Transplant
The hematopoietic stem cell transplant (HSCT) segment is a less commonly adopted but potentially curative intervention for LAL-D, especially in pediatric patients with rapidly progressing forms. HSCT aims to restore normal enzyme activity by replacing the faulty immune system with a healthy one. It is estimated that less than 10% of LAL-D cases are treated using HSCT due to high procedural risk and donor limitations. Nevertheless, advances in transplant techniques have improved survival outcomes and reduced complications, making it an emerging option in specialized centers.
Lysosomal Acid Lipase Deficiency Treatment Market, Segmentation by DrugType
The Lysosomal Acid Lipase Deficiency Treatment Market has been segmented by DrugType into Statins and Other Dyslipidemia Drugs and Sebelipase Alfa (Kanuma).
Statins and Other Dyslipidemia Drugs
The Statins and Other Dyslipidemia Drugs segment accounts for a supportive role in managing Lysosomal Acid Lipase Deficiency (LAL-D) by targeting elevated cholesterol and lipid levels. These drugs help reduce the risk of atherosclerosis and liver complications. However, their efficacy in treating the underlying enzyme deficiency is limited. Around 30% to 35% of patients with LAL-D are prescribed statins or similar lipid-lowering agents to manage symptoms rather than modify disease progression.
Sebelipase Alfa (Kanuma)
Sebelipase Alfa, commercially known as Kanuma, is the only enzyme replacement therapy approved specifically for LAL-D. It directly addresses the root cause of the disorder by supplementing the deficient lysosomal acid lipase enzyme. Clinical trials have shown that up to 80% to 85% of patients treated with Kanuma experience significant improvements in liver function and lipid profiles. This drug dominates the treatment landscape due to its targeted therapeutic benefits and favorable safety profile.
Lysosomal Acid Lipase Deficiency Treatment Market, Segmentation by Indication
The Lysosomal Acid Lipase Deficiency Treatment Market has been segmented by Indication into Wolman Disease (WD) and Cholesteryl Ester Storage Disease (CESD).
Wolman Disease (WD)
Wolman Disease is the more severe and infantile-onset form of Lysosomal Acid Lipase Deficiency (LAL-D), typically presenting within the first few weeks of life. It is extremely rare, accounting for approximately 10% to 15% of all LAL-D cases. Patients with WD often experience rapid disease progression involving liver failure, adrenal calcification, and severe malnutrition. Without effective intervention, mortality rates in untreated infants can exceed 90% within the first year of life.
Cholesteryl Ester Storage Disease (CESD)
Cholesteryl Ester Storage Disease represents the milder, late-onset form of LAL-D, comprising nearly 85% to 90% of diagnosed cases. CESD typically manifests during childhood or adolescence and progresses more slowly, often leading to dyslipidemia, hepatomegaly, and hepatic fibrosis. Many patients are undiagnosed until adulthood due to the nonspecific nature of symptoms. Timely treatment significantly improves clinical outcomes and quality of life in CESD patients.
